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Window Repairs Near Me

double glazing repair-glazed windows enhance your home's energy efficiency, security, and appearance. They are often backed by a warranty to cover any problems you may encounter after installation.

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gThere are a few typical problems that require assistance from a professional. Here's a look at some of them:

Glass Replacement

Double-glazed windows aren't just beautiful, they also have many benefits, including energy efficiency, reduced outside noise levels and UV protection, as well as ease of maintenance, and an increase in property value. But, just like any other piece of home equipment or furniture double glazing may encounter issues and require regular maintenance to keep them in good working order. If you are experiencing issues with your double-glazed windows, it is important to contact a trusted repair service as soon as possible.

Double glazing owners frequently report that their doors and windows are difficult to open or close. In some cases, this is caused by the weather, window replacement near me particularly in extreme temperatures, which can cause frames to shrink or expand. In this case, wiping down the frame with cold tap water can help. If the issue persists, it is best to call the manufacturer of your double glazing.

Another issue that is common is that the glass itself may become damaged. In some cases it is possible to repair the damage by simply replacing the pane of glass. In other cases the entire window could need to be replaced. The most reliable companies will assure that the replacement is of high quality and meets industry standards in terms of insulation and safety. They will also ensure that the replacement window is put in place properly so that it does not alter the integrity of your entire window.

Depending on the type of double-glazed window and the manufacturer, the cost of fixing or replacing the glass will vary. You should always consult an expert for advice on the best option for your requirements.

Double-paned windows consist of two glass panes which are held together with an inert gas, like the gas argon. The gas slows down heat transfer between the panes and decreases the amount of heat entering the building. The gas also helps to prevent condensation and the formation of mist in the frame. Seal Replacement

One of the simplest and less expensive options for window repairs is to replace the insulated glass unit (IGU). A triple-paned or double-paned Window replacement Near Me is insulated by either argon or krypton gas vacuum sandwiched between the windows. If the seal breaks moisture can enter between the panes and cause damage to the frame. A professional can take off the damaged window, replace it with inert gases and create the seal at a reasonable cost.

Some homeowners try to repair windows on their own, but this task is best left to professionals. A minor error made during resealing may cause permanent damage to the window seal. In addition, trying a DIY repair to a window seal can be dangerous for those with a weak balance or poor dexterity.

If you decide to hire an expert window repair service for the replacement of a seal, ask about other options that are energy efficient that they might offer. You could add a low-E coating on the glass or paint the frames with a light color to reflect sun's rays. This will keep your home cooler.

If the window seal is damaged, moisture could seep through the glass panes of the windows and cause damage to your home's walls. This can be expensive and disruptive, but it's important to fix the issue before it gets any worse.

A window seal breaking isn't just a problem but it can also negatively impact the efficiency of your home. Moisture that gets in between the windows' glass panes will decrease your energy efficiency and increase your electricity bills. It is therefore a good idea to have the seal replaced as soon as possible.

If you're looking to avoid the hassle of damaged window seals, you need to install high-quality windows from the start. This is a good investment that will last for years or even decades, thereby saving you the expense of replacing your windows in the future. Window maintenance is equally important. For example, re-caulking the frame where the glass meets the wall could reduce the amount of temperature and moisture that can affect the windows.

Frame Repair

To be energy efficient window frames must be in good shape to hold the glass and seal the airtight gaps between the panes. They are also susceptible to damage by wear and weather, requiring upvc repair or replacement. Window frame repairs can cost between $150 and $600 in average. The frame is stripped of its old caulk, putty, and paint and replaced with new ones. Also, they include setting all the windows back and tightening the hardware.

Professional replacement of window hinges cost between $75 and 200 dollars. This includes all parts and labor required for the replacement. The window hinges help to support the weight of the window sash when it opens and shuts. They also keep the window stable and in place. They are susceptible to breaking or worn down, or misaligned due to the aging process and frequent use.

A window sash is the movable panel in hung windows and should be replaced in order to ensure the airtight seal between the windows. Window sash replacement costs about $250-$600 on average, based on the size and the type of sash. Window sash is more costly to replace than glass since the new sash must be precisely sized to fit the frame.

In extreme conditions, double-paned windows are used to provide insulation. However, they can be damaged by storms or normal usage. The seals could rupture, leading to condensation between the panes of glass and reducing energy efficiency. Double-paned windows must be repaired as soon as possible if they are damaged.

Double-pane window repair service costs between $300 and $880 per pane of glass. The repair process could include taking out the broken glass, repairing or replacing the frame, and then installing a new sealing material. They may also recommend adding storm windows or solar film to improve energy efficiency. If you've had experience in building, you can typically complete the work yourself. To save money on repairing or replacing double-pane windows, homeowners can buy windows that are high-efficiency and have an insulation glass unit. These windows are more expensive than regular windows, but they will save you money on energy bills. Additionally, these windows can be adapted to the specific needs of every home and come with a warrantee.

Misted Window Repair

Many homeowners choose double-glazed windows because of their energy-saving capabilities. They can also help maintain a comfortable temperature. However, they're not impervious to damage and can sometimes suffer from damages that require repair. The misting of windows is caused by condensation between the glass panes. While this may not seem like a major issue, it can seriously impact the aesthetics and functionality of your home.

A leak in the seal is the reason of misty windows. This allows moisture to enter the insulation section, reducing its effectiveness, and causing fogging. Although this may not be a huge issue, it's crucial to fix it immediately.

A glass that is misty is not only unsightly but can also cause your property value to decrease. It also blocks natural light and reduces visibility, making your home look less appealing and darker. Additionally, it could reduce the energy efficiency of your home, and also increase the cost of cooling or heating.

The best way to prevent a misty window is to make sure the frame and seal are in good working order. Regular maintenance carried out by a professional technician will help to keep the glass and seals in tip-top shape. If you do spot a sign of condensation, it's crucial to contact a specialist to complete double glazing window repairs immediately.

When installing double glazing, the gap between two glass panes will be filled with an inert gas like the argon, krypton or radon, which slows down the heat transfer. This helps to keep the interior of your home insulated however it could lead to misting when the seal fails.

A window specialist can repair a broken seal through drilling holes into the unit and then inserting drying agents. This is less expensive than replacing the entire unit, but it could be less efficient or durable. In some cases it may be required to replace the entire unit to avoid recurrence.
